JENKINTOWN, Pa. – The Centenary University volleyball team used a total team effort to record a 3-0 win over Manor College on Thursday evening.
The Cyclones matched their win total from a year ago by picking up their fifth win of the fall campaign.
Centenary secured the match with set wins of 25-5, 25-7 and 25-4.
Mya Burnett led the Cyclones with seven kills on nine attempts while
Vanessa Pagano added seven assists and three service aces.
Martina Josifoska had eight service aces and three digs while
Asia Logan added six service aces.
Argylle Kelly led Manor with two assists and three digs.
Centenary is back in action on Wednesday, Oct. 12 when it hosts Marywood at 7 p.m.
